By putting this value in total energy of an electron and convert the unit in eV, we get E n n = −13 6 2 . eV Negative value shows that electron is bound to nucleus. Limitation of Bohr’s atomic model: Bohr’s model is for hydrogenic atoms. It does not hold true for a multi-electron model.
